    U.S. Army Reserve Soldiers from the 739th Multi-Role Bridge Company, Granite City, prepare to return to the near shore with their barge in order to complete an Improved Ribbon Bridge (IRB) as Soldiers from the 469th MAC, Dodgeville, Wisconsin, and the 194th MP Company, Fort Knox, Kentucky, assault and secure the far side objective, during River Assault, Fort Chaffee, Arkansas, July 25, 2018. River Assault is a key U.S. Army Reserve training event, ran by the 420th Engineer Brigade, that the 416th TEC employs to prepare trained and ready engineer units and Soldiers (U.S. Army photo by Sgt. 1st Class Jason Proseus/416th TEC).
